VERSE OF THE DAY:
Just then Boaz arrived from
“The Lord
be with you!” “The Lord
bless you!” they called back. Ruth 2:4 NIV
The Passing of the Peace done at First Christian Church
has its origins in the above verse.
Boaz was good man. He treated his workers
fairly. He allowed the poor (like Ruth) to glean, according to the Mosaic
Law (see Leviticus 19:9-10), even when some of the others didn’t (implied by his
words to Ruth in verses 8-13). He followed the law when he sought to marry
her. The story ends with him marrying this young woman he was so enamored
with and becoming the great-grandfather of King David. Who says nice guys
finish last? His epitaph probably read, “He did what was right in the eyes of
the Lord”. Isn’t that what we would want to be said about us? Just
like Boaz, God gives us the opportunities to do right. What you make of
those opportunities is up to you.
